Client Profile
Changning Library spans approximately 16,000 square meters, housing a collection of over 500,000 books, 1,000+ Chinese and foreign periodicals, and 1,200 reading seats. With its scientific layout, comprehensive facilities, and forward-thinking development philosophy, the library embodies Changning District's international exchange function and 'Digital Changning' characteristics. As a vital information hub for collection, dissemination, and cultural enrichment in the district, it was honored as the 'Most Reader-Favorite Library' by China's Ministry of Culture. -
Customer pain points
As the quality and diversity of social and cultural life continue to improve, public demand for enhanced digital public cultural services has grown significantly. In May 2022, the General Office of the CPC Central Committee and the General Office of the State Council issued the 'Opinions on Promoting the Implementation of the National Cultural Digitalization Strategy,' which identifies 'improving the digitalization level of public cultural services' as a key task of this national strategy. As early as June 2021, the Ministry of Culture and Tourism's '14th Five-Year Plan for Public Cultural Service System Construction' had already designated 'advancing the digital, networked, and intelligent development of public cultural services' as a primary objective.
Changning Library serves as a pilot project for Shanghai's smart library initiative, having launched multiple intelligent reading scenarios and service systems since 2021. Working in collaboration with SenseTime, Changning District Library has co-developed Shanghai's first 'Smart Library,' delivering a rich, user-friendly reading experience while demonstrating advanced construction concepts, innovative reading environments, and the public nature of cultural services. This initiative has significantly advanced the intelligent transformation of library services. -

Implementation results
SenseTime has deeply integrated its cutting-edge AI technologies into library scenarios, empowering Changning Library's end-to-end intelligent book borrowing and returning services. From intelligent interaction and appointment systems to personalized book recommendations and automated book delivery, the solution delivers a fully digitalized reading experience that truly advances smart library services.
The AI-powered digital librarian 'Xinye' was developed using SenseTime's latest digital human technology, incorporating advanced computer vision, natural language processing, and decision intelligence. By analyzing big data to understand individual reading preferences, Xinye can recommend popular and personalized books, while assisting with book borrowing and seat reservations. Capable of engaging in natural, lifelike conversations with expressive gestures and facial expressions, Xinye significantly enhances human-computer interaction. The recommendation algorithm, specially tailored for library scenarios, continuously improves its suggestions based on usage patterns, ensuring readers discover books better suited to their interests while maximizing the value of each book in the library's collection.
Changning Library offers two reading options: 'In-Library Reading' and 'Self-Service Pickup.' For 'In-Library Reading,' after seat reservation and check-in, an AI-powered smart reading robot delivers the selected books directly to the reader's seat. Upon successful verification code input, the robot's 'compartment' automatically opens to complete the borrowing process. After reading, the same robot facilitates convenient returns. For 'Self-Service Pickup,' readers can opt for a contactless mode using SenseTime's touch-free smart cabinets to retrieve their reserved books at any time, significantly improving the convenience of book borrowing and returning.
